I just finished Emily Wilde’s Encyclopaedia of Faeries by Heather Fawcett, and what a charming read it was! This atmospheric fantasy, set in 1909, follows the brilliant yet socially awkward scholar Emily Wilde as she journeys to a remote village to study the elusive fae. With its richly detailed world, wintry themes, and a touch of romance, this book feels like stepping into a cozy, magical adventure. Though perfect for a winter evening, Emily Wilde’s Encyclopaedia of Faeries would also make a delightful springtime read especially if you love folklore, academia, and a little bit of whimsy.
